Business Model

What each company does and how it makes money

BLZEBackblaze, Inc.
Technology

Backblaze is a cloud storage platform that provides businesses and consumers with affordable data backup and storage solutions. It generates revenue primarily through two subscription services: B2 Cloud Storage for developers and businesses (consumption-based IaaS) and Computer Backup for individual users (flat-rate SaaS), with B2 representing its fastest-growing segment. The company's key advantage is its cost-efficient architecture built on commodity hardware, which allows it to offer cloud storage at roughly one-fifth the price of major hyperscalers.

CRWVCoreWeave, Inc. Class A Common Stock
Technology

CoreWeave operates a specialized cloud computing platform focused on GPU-accelerated workloads for artificial intelligence and high-performance computing. It generates revenue primarily through its cloud infrastructure services — including GPU compute, storage, and managed services — with GPU compute being its largest segment. The company's competitive advantage lies in its specialized infrastructure optimized for AI workloads and its early access to scarce high-end NVIDIA GPUs.
